Output fa28ad86ebc09c158cb75460bdd2bfa16faa0f3e422648a4ad71d50d865969cc:18

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e94fb70de1eab8c318db3d49f328661e8071e604 OP_EQUALVERIFY OP_CHECKSIG
address
1NGdwPwxwjL14u41iEYk4fdT7SLTJRq2zo
transaction
fa28ad86ebc09c158cb75460bdd2bfa16faa0f3e422648a4ad71d50d865969cc
confirmations
287530
spent
true